General-duty citation text
Section 5(a)(1) of the Occupational Safety and Health Act of 1970; The employer did not furnish employment and a place of employment which was free from recognized hazards which were likely to cause death or serious physical harm to employees in that employees were exposed to fall hazards exceeding 24 feet while working at the edge of the roof line without guardrails or other fall protection being provided. Among other methods, one feasible and acceptable abatement method to correct this hazardous condition would be install static lines and require safety belts with lanyards.
